WebHere’s how to thaw steaks in a microwave: Step One: Remove the steaks from their packaging and place them, one at a time, on a microwaveable plate. Do not put the steak onto the plate in its original packaging. Step Two: Set your microwave to ‘Defrost’, or alternatively to 30-50% power. Cook each steak for two minutes on this setting ... WebAug 31, 2024 · First, thaw foods slowly and evenly in the refrigerator. This method takes the longest, but it is also the safest and easiest. Alternatively, thaw frozen meat in a bowl of cold water. This method is faster than using the refrigerator and gentler than the microwave. WebFeb 8, 2024 · Set your microwave to the defrost setting (or, change it to 40-50% power) and microwave the beef for 30 seconds. Flip the ground beef and continue to microwave in 20-30 second increments, flipping after each, until the beef is defrosted.
